Broccoli, which belongs to the cruciferous family, is an excellent source of fiber and nutrients, regardless of whether it is consumed raw or cooked.
Only 6 grams of carbohydrates and 2.5 grams of fiber are found in one cup of broccoli that has been cut using a knife.
Research has indicated that broccoli sprouts are excellent for people who are living with type 2 diabetes.
